Contrast

#dd3148 as textRatioAAAA largeAAAFix
Aaon white
4.56:1passpassfail
  • AAA: use #ab1c2f as the text (7.15:1)
Aaon black
4.61:1passpassfail
  • AAA: use #e87382 as the text (7.21:1)

Fixes keep hue and saturation and move lightness only, so the suggestion stays on-brand. Ratios are symmetric: the same numbers apply with #dd3148 as the background.
